Mdex is an automated market maker (AMM) based decentralized exchange (DEX) utilizing capital pool mechanisms. The platform operates on a dual-chain DEX model spanning Huobi Eco Chain (HECO) and Ethereum, combining the advantages of low transaction costs from HECO with the robust ecosystem of Ethereum.

Investment Implications: The absence of a maximum supply cap presents a structural constraint on long-term scarcity value. Unlike Bitcoin or other capped-supply assets, MDX's unlimited maximum supply suggests potential indefinite future inflation. This mechanism differs fundamentally from assets deriving value from artificial scarcity, potentially limiting its utility as a store of value or inflation hedge.

Q1: What is Mdex (MDX) and how does it function as a decentralized exchange?
A: Mdex is an automated market making (AMM) decentralized exchange built on capital pool mechanisms, operating across multiple blockchain networks including Huobi Eco Chain (HECO) and Ethereum. The platform integrates three core components: DEX (decentralized exchange for token swaps), IMO (Initial Market Offering for token launches), and DAO (decentralized governance). It combines low transaction costs from HECO with the robust ecosystem of Ethereum, offering dual mining mechanisms that reward both liquidity providers and active traders.

Q3: How has MDX performed historically, and what are the key price milestones?
A: MDX reached its all-time high (ATH) of $10.06 on February 22, 2021, approximately one month after launch, representing a peak return of 1,912% from the initial price of $0.50. However, the token has since experienced severe depreciation, reaching an all-time low (ATL) of $0.000691 on December 20, 2025—a 99.93% decline from the ATH and a 94.26% decline over the past year. This significant depreciation reflects broader market challenges affecting altcoin and DEX tokens.
Q4: What is the token supply structure, and does MDX have a maximum supply cap?
A: MDX has a total supply of 1,060,000,000 tokens with 950,246,937 tokens currently in circulation (89.65% circulation ratio). Critically, MDX has an unlimited maximum supply (∞), meaning there is no hard cap on total token issuance. This unlimited supply structure differs from capped-supply assets like Bitcoin and presents structural constraints on long-term scarcity value, potentially enabling indefinite future inflation.
